hello, i have a tech. question about my 94 explorer. I am having problems with the push buttom 4 wheel. I am thinking of converting over to manuel shift 4x4 but need to know if i can still run the truck after removal of the actuator motor from the trans. case? The truck is a dailly driver and i dont wont to fix stuff that would brake for my stupidity. thanks.

Welcome To The Forum! You need the whole manual t-case to make it manual, from the way I understand it you want to make the electric shifted tcase into a manual.
 






thanks for the info x92. do u think it would run alright with the actuator taken off the case so i could manually (by hand) swith it untill the switch over of the assembly?
 












welcome
 






You can take the motor off with no issues. There is a rebuild thread on the shift motor. Mine was too far gone and had to be replaced. It was about $250.
 






I think it'd be easier to just replace or rebuild the shift motor rather than convert your truck to the manual shift. (just my opinion)
